Ticonderoga CDP, New York: commercial real estate data.

Ticonderoga CDP is a Census CDP of 3,260 people across 4.27 square miles of land, in Essex County. Median household income is $54,938, 63.5 percent of occupied homes are owned, and the SBA record carries 8 7(a) approvals to borrowers here worth $6.6 m.

How many people live in Ticonderoga, New York?

3,260, in 1,325 households. Ticonderoga CDP covers 4.27 square miles of land, which is 763 people per square mile. Source: US Census Bureau, American Community Survey 5-Year Estimates, place level, 2020-2024 5-year.

What county is Ticonderoga in?

Essex County, which holds 100.0 percent of the place by area. Source: US Census Bureau, cartographic boundary file, places, 2024 vintage.

What is the median household income in Ticonderoga?

$54,938. The median owner-occupied home is valued at $158,200. Median gross rent is $847 per month. Source: US Census Bureau, American Community Survey 5-Year Estimates, place level, 2020-2024 5-year.
